Substrate dependent linear and nonlinear optical properties of chalcogenide Se82Te15Bi3.0 thin film

Abstract

Current work report the substrate dependent linear (n) and nonlinear refractive index (n2) of chalcogenide Se82Te15Bi3.0 thin films. n is determined using Swanepoel method and n2 is computed using Tichy and Ticha approach.
